One of the most popular building permit-related questions last year was, "What do I need to install a new generator in my home?" according to Amherst Community Development Director Sarah Marchant.
She has all of the answers in her department's newsletter that launched recently:

There are two kinds of generators: Portable and Standby. Both types of generators require an Electrical Permit and inspection by the Building Inspector, to ensure the required separate service-rated disconnect is installed per the National Electric Code.
Standby generators also require a Gas Piping Permit and Inspection from the Fire Inspector.

Both permits can be obtained and applied for through the Community Development Office.
All permit application forms are available online at www.amherstnh.gov/forms-permits-fees/.
